工程合同管理信息系统的数据设计理念

  • 来源:建米软件
  • 2012-01-04 17:11:54

   一、工程合同管理流程系统数据库设计

  建立数据库是为了更有效地管理数据、获取信息,一般的用户都是通过应用程序使用数据库的,用户的应用程序体现了信息系统的功能。设计数据库和设计建立在数据库之上的应用程序是开发信息系统的主要工作。所以数据库设计极其重要。数据库设计得是否全面、合理、规范,直接关系到酒店系统的功能能否实现,效果如何。数据库设计的合理,后续程序开发将取得事半功倍的效果,否则将会加大编程的工作量,甚至要回头重新修改数据库,因此本系统才用了规范化的设计方法。

  按照前面功能设计提出的总体要求,设计酒店系统的数据库应该有如下特点:结构较简单、数据关系明确、容量小、执行效率高。

  1、数据库概念模型设计

  概念模型使用用户易于理解的概念、符号、表达方式来描述事物及其联系,是对信息世界的建模,能够方便、准确地表示出信息世界中的常用概念。目前常用的一个数据模型是模型。E-R模型通过描述系统内所有实体及其属性以及实体间的联系来建立信息系统的概念模型。

  2、表的建立

  我们创建7个数据库基本表:项目注册表、承包合同登记表、承包合同结算表、承包合同变更及索赔表、分包合同登记表、分包合同结算表以及用户表。

  二、泛普工程合同管理流程系统安全性设计

  

工程合同管理信息系统结构图

 

  鉴于合同管理信息系统对整个企业的影响,系统的安全性设计非常重要。本生产管理信息系统的安全性可分为两个方面,即硬件方面和软件方面。

  在硬件方面,在选择计算机及外设等硬件设备时,应优先考虑设备的质量;在机房建设和网络布线时,要严格遵守相应的施工标准;同时数据库服务器应采用双机热备份;数据应采用多种备份方式加以备份。通过以上手段尽可能地将因硬件故障系统带来的损害降低到最低。

  在软件方面,主要是系统登陆安全性和数据库安全性。系统登陆安全性可以为每个使用生产管理信息系统的用户设置登陆账号和相应权限,阻止非法用户的进入。数据库的安全性是管理信息系统中最关键的安全性问题,在安全设计和安全使用中应特别注意以下两点:

  1、数据库的安全性

  本合同管理信息系统的逻辑安全性环节有:存贮信息的安全、访问信息的安全和传输信息的安全。数据库的安全性是指保护数据库以防止不合法的使用,避免数据的泄露、更改和破坏。数据库安全性的基本原则是控制用户对数据库的访问,只有被识别的允许的用户才有输入、删除、修改和查询信息的权利。数据库的安全性由数据库管理系统的内部构件实现。数据库管理系统的加密机制和访问控制机制是数据库安全性的保证。

  2、数据库的恢复

  数据库系统投入运行后,数据库可能会出现各式各样的故障,所谓数据库恢复就是指数据库管理系统把数据库从错误的状态恢复到某一已知的正确状态的功能,数据库的恢复的手段一般有两种,一是利用转储备份的恢复,即数据库管理员定期地将数据库复制到磁盘上作为备份,当数据库遭到破坏后,可用这一备份对数据库进行恢复;一是利用日志文件进行恢复。

  

工程合同系统登记表

 

  三、泛普工程合同管理流程系统程序的设计与实现

  1、系统实现的技术支持

  我们采用了数据库来进行编程以及建立数据库。

  泛普提供了大量的控件,这些控件可用于设计界面和实现各种功能,减少了编程人员的工作量,也简化了界面设计过程,从而有效地提高了应用程序的运行效率和可靠性。所以实现本系统是一个相对较好的选择。

预约免费体验 让管理无忧

微信咨询

扫码获取服务 扫码获取服务

添加专属销售顾问

扫码获取一对一服务